Amoxicillin Haptenation of α-Enolase is Modulated by Active Site Occupancy and Acetylation

Allergic reactions to antibiotics are a major concern in the clinic. ß-lactam antibiotics are the class most frequently reported to cause hypersensitivity reactions.
